    ABOUT THIS FEATURED OPPORTUNITY

    The main function of a Compliance Program Manager (PM) for Accessories is to plan, direct, or coordinate activities in such fields as engineering, research and development, and product roll-out, etc. or any other non-IT based project. This role will function as part of a team embedded in the product development of accessories, gathering and communications requirements while tracking important program milestones.

    Compliance PM is expected to have a good understanding of consumer electronics, analytical testing, demonstrated experience in program management and has worked in a collaborative cross functional, fast-paced environment.
